Israeli forces raid cities and towns in West Bank and Quds
[Thu, 17 Jul 2025 15:46:27 +0300]


Ramallah / Occupied Quds - Saba:

On Thursday, Israeli forces launched raids and incursions into several cities and towns in the West Bank and occupied Quds, arresting and detaining Palestinian citizens.

In Hebron, Israeli forces raided the towns of Beit Kahil and Halhul, north of Hebron, and several neighborhoods in the city. These forces detained more than 20 citizens, including released prisoners, and abused them. They conducted field investigations at the Asafir Court in the town before releasing them.

They also raided the town of Halhul in the north and searched several homes. They also raided the Sahla area in the southern part of Hebron and searched several homes.

In Tulkarm, Israeli forces launched a raid campaign in the villages of Kafr Jamal and Kafr Zibad, south of Tulkarm.

Local Palestinian sources reported that the Israeli army set up a military checkpoint at the entrance to the village of Kafr Jamal, and deployed forces inside and on its outskirts.

Israeli forces also raided a number of homes in the village, hours after raiding a citizen's home.

In the same context, Israeli forces stormed the neighboring village of Kafr Zibad, raided a home, and transformed it into a closed military checkpoint, obstructing citizens' movement to and from their work.

In Ramallah, Israeli forces raided the town of Beitunia, west of Ramallah, and the Ein Munjid neighborhood in Ramallah. Israeli soldiers raided a citizen's home and arrested a young man from the village of Deir Ibzi', west of Ramallah.

The Palestinian WAFA News Agency reported that the Israeli army arrested Amir Ibrahim Abdul Rasoul al-Tawil, 24, after raiding and searching his home.

In Jenin, Israeli forces raided the town of Qabatiya, south of Jenin, arrested a Palestinian citizen, and detained others.

Local sources reported that a large Israeli army force stormed the town, accompanied by a military bulldozer, raiding several homes and destroying their contents.

In occupied Quds, Israeli forces stormed the town of Anata, northeast of occupied Quds, on Thursday.

The Quds Governorate reported that Israeli forces stormed the town's Al-Buhaira neighborhood, but no arrests were reported.
